How Much Does a Scottish Terrier Cost?
A Scottish Terrier, also known as a Scottie, is one of the five breeds of Terriers that originated from Scotland. Others include terriers such as the Dandie Dinmont and Cairn. On average, a Scottish Terrier can stand up to 10 inches tall and weigh up to 22 pounds. Males usually outweigh the females by 1 or 2 pounds. Common colors that are found include black and wheaton. The cost of a Scottish Terrier will depend on the breeder, quality, location, age, and other factors.
How much is it?
- On average, a Scottie can cost anywhere from $400 to as much as $1,200. It is not uncommon to find AKC quality based terriers selling for $1,400 or more.
- Sites such as PuppyFind.com have breeders listing their Terriers for anywhere from $450 to as much as $1,100.
- Older dogs that are over the age of 2 can cost anywhere from $200 to $500. For example, a non-profit organization in Dallas, Texas by the name of Scottie Kingdom Rescue, Inc has many older Scotties up for adoption.
- According to an article on the website ScottishTerrierNews.com, the user had stated that she paid upwards of $1,400 for her Terrier. She also noted that some breeders will be more than happy to offer a discount during the slower periods of the month.
What are the extra costs?
- If you are going to purchase the dog outside of a driving distance, shipping will be an additional cost. Many breeders tend to choose major airlines for their shipping needs. Shipping a dog can cost anywhere from $150 to $350.
- While some breeders include pet insurance with your adoption fee, some consider this an additional purchase.
- Once you receive the dog, it is ideal to take it to the vet to ensure that it has a clean bill of health. If the dog has problems and the breeder included a health guarantee, there should be no problem getting your money back.
What is going to be included?
- Reputable breeders will include up to date vaccinations as well as any medical paperwork that includes an initial health examination, etc.
- A health guarantee comes included with a lot of puppies today. Be sure to know about the terms and conditions before adopting a dog because there are some restrictions.
- For those that are going to be shipped, a crate will be included.
- Adoption agencies generally will send out a starter package that includes food, toys and other material.

How can I save money?
- If you do not want the hassle of training a puppy, consider checking with an adoption agency to see if there are any older dogs available.
- Try your best to purchase a dog within driving distance. Shipping fees can easily surpass the $250 mark on top of the dog’s price.
